“I’m a Jain. Jainism is an ancient religion from India, and we believe in no harm towards anything or anyone. For example, I’m a vegetarian, and I don’t eat root vegetables, as removing them from the ground can damage a variety of organisms. We acknowledge 24 gods, so we practice polytheism like in Hinduism.

I have a spiritual group in Singapore that hosts frequent Jain events and activities where we get to learn even more about ourselves and our culture. Being a part of such a tight knit community really helped me as a person.

In 2014, my guru (spiritual mentor) visited Singapore. We talked about how living abroad can sometimes make people feel disconnected. However, I realized then that my dedication and involvement with the Jain community makes it me feel like I am much closer to home.”
